### Windows Service
Run these from an elevated PowerShell session (Run as Administrator):
Requires .NET SDK 10+ (installer publishes a native service host executable).
Install and start at boot:
```powershell
.\install_backend_service.ps1 -ForceReinstall -StartAfterInstall -DelayedAutoStart
```
Check status:
```powershell
Get-Service -Name ScreenJobBackend
```
Stop/start manually:
```powershell
Stop-Service -Name ScreenJobBackend
Start-Service -Name ScreenJobBackend
```
Uninstall:
```powershell
.\uninstall_backend_service.ps1
```
Service logs are written to:
```text
screenjob_runs/service/backend-service.stdout.log
screenjob_runs/service/backend-service.stderr.log
```
### System Tray Icon (Windows)
Start tray icon now:
```powershell
powershell -NoProfile -ExecutionPolicy Bypass -STA -File .\screenjob_tray.ps1
```
Install startup shortcut (current user):
```powershell
.\install_tray_startup_shortcut.ps1
```
Install startup shortcut for all users:
```powershell
.\install_tray_startup_shortcut.ps1 -AllUsers
```
Remove startup shortcut:
```powershell
.\install_tray_startup_shortcut.ps1 -Remove
```
Tray menu actions:
- Refresh service status
- Start/Stop/Restart service (prompts for admin/UAC)
- Open dashboard URL from `.env` `SCREENJOB_HOST` / `SCREENJOB_PORT`
- Open service logs folder
- Exit tray icon process

[CmdletBinding(SupportsShouldProcess = $true)]
param(
[string]$ServiceName = "ScreenJobBackend",
[string]$DisplayName = "ScreenJob Backend",
[string]$Description = "Runs the ScreenJob backend (start_backend.ps1) as a Windows service.",
[ValidateSet("Automatic", "Manual", "Disabled")]
[string]$StartupType = "Automatic",
[switch]$DelayedAutoStart,
[switch]$ForceReinstall,
[switch]$StartAfterInstall
)
Set-StrictMode -Version Latest
$ErrorActionPreference = "Stop"
function Test-IsAdministrator {
$identity = [Security.Principal.WindowsIdentity]::GetCurrent()
$principal = New-Object Security.Principal.WindowsPrincipal($identity)
return $principal.IsInRole([Security.Principal.WindowsBuiltInRole]::Administrator)
}
if (-not (Test-IsAdministrator)) {
throw "Run this script from an elevated PowerShell session (Run as Administrator)."
}
$scriptDir = Split-Path -Parent $PSCommandPath
$backendScript = Join-Path $scriptDir "start_backend.ps1"
if (-not (Test-Path -LiteralPath $backendScript)) {
throw "Backend launcher script not found: $backendScript"
}
$projectFile = Join-Path $scriptDir "service_host\ScreenJob.WindowsServiceHost\ScreenJob.WindowsServiceHost.csproj"
if (-not (Test-Path -LiteralPath $projectFile)) {
throw "Windows service host project not found: $projectFile"
}
$dotnetCmd = Get-Command dotnet -ErrorAction SilentlyContinue
if ($null -eq $dotnetCmd) {
throw "dotnet SDK was not found in PATH. Install .NET SDK 10+ and retry."
}
$publishDir = Join-Path $scriptDir "service_host\publish"
$serviceExe = Join-Path $publishDir "ScreenJob.WindowsServiceHost.exe"
$logDir = Join-Path $scriptDir "screenjob_runs\service"
$existingService = Get-Service -Name $ServiceName -ErrorAction SilentlyContinue
if ($null -ne $existingService) {
if (-not $ForceReinstall) {
throw "Service '$ServiceName' already exists. Re-run with -ForceReinstall to replace it."
}
if ($PSCmdlet.ShouldProcess($ServiceName, "Remove existing service")) {
if ($existingService.Status -ne "Stopped") {
Stop-Service -Name $ServiceName -Force -ErrorAction Stop
}
& sc.exe delete $ServiceName | Out-Null
if ($LASTEXITCODE -ne 0) {
throw "Failed to delete existing service '$ServiceName' (sc.exe exit code $LASTEXITCODE)."
}
$deadline = (Get-Date).AddSeconds(15)
while ((Get-Date) -lt $deadline) {
$stillThere = Get-Service -Name $ServiceName -ErrorAction SilentlyContinue
if ($null -eq $stillThere) {
break
}
Start-Sleep -Milliseconds 300
}
}
}
if ($PSCmdlet.ShouldProcess($projectFile, "Publish Windows service host")) {
if (Test-Path -LiteralPath $serviceExe) {
Remove-Item -LiteralPath $serviceExe -Force -ErrorAction SilentlyContinue
}
& $dotnetCmd.Source publish `
$projectFile `
-c Release `
-r win-x64 `
--self-contained false `
-p:PublishSingleFile=true `
-o $publishDir
if ($LASTEXITCODE -ne 0) {
throw "dotnet publish failed with exit code $LASTEXITCODE."
}
}
if (-not (Test-Path -LiteralPath $serviceExe)) {
throw "Published service executable not found: $serviceExe"
}
$binaryPath = "`"$serviceExe`" --backend-script `"$backendScript`" --working-dir `"$scriptDir`" --log-dir `"$logDir`""
if ($PSCmdlet.ShouldProcess($ServiceName, "Create service")) {
New-Service `
-Name $ServiceName `
-BinaryPathName $binaryPath `
-DisplayName $DisplayName `
-Description $Description `
-StartupType $StartupType
if ($StartupType -eq "Automatic" -and $DelayedAutoStart) {
& sc.exe config $ServiceName start= delayed-auto | Out-Null
if ($LASTEXITCODE -ne 0) {
throw "Failed to enable delayed auto-start for '$ServiceName' (sc.exe exit code $LASTEXITCODE)."
}
}
# Restart on first/second/subsequent failure after 5 seconds.
& sc.exe failure $ServiceName reset= 86400 actions= restart/5000/restart/5000/restart/5000 | Out-Null
if ($LASTEXITCODE -ne 0) {
throw "Failed to configure failure actions for '$ServiceName' (sc.exe exit code $LASTEXITCODE)."
}
if ($StartAfterInstall) {
Start-Service -Name $ServiceName -ErrorAction Stop
}
}
Write-Host "Service '$ServiceName' installed successfully." -ForegroundColor Green
Write-Host "Check status with: Get-Service -Name $ServiceName"
Write-Host "View logs in: $logDir"

using System.Diagnostics;
using Microsoft.Extensions.Hosting;
using Microsoft.Extensions.Logging;
namespace ScreenJob.WindowsServiceHost;
internal sealed class BackendProcessService : BackgroundService
{
private readonly ILogger<BackendProcessService> _logger;
private readonly ServiceOptions _options;
private readonly object _logLock = new();
private Process? _backendProcess;
private string _stdoutLogPath = string.Empty;
private string _stderrLogPath = string.Empty;
public BackendProcessService(ILogger<BackendProcessService> logger, ServiceOptions options)
{
_logger = logger;
_options = options;
}
protected override async Task ExecuteAsync(CancellationToken stoppingToken)
{
Directory.CreateDirectory(_options.LogDirectory);
_stdoutLogPath = Path.Combine(_options.LogDirectory, "backend-service.stdout.log");
_stderrLogPath = Path.Combine(_options.LogDirectory, "backend-service.stderr.log");
LogStdOut("Service host starting backend process.");
LogStdOut($"Script: {_options.BackendScriptPath}");
LogStdOut($"Working directory: {_options.WorkingDirectory}");
var powershellPath = Path.Combine(
Environment.GetFolderPath(Environment.SpecialFolder.Windows),
"System32",
"WindowsPowerShell",
"v1.0",
"powershell.exe");
var startInfo = new ProcessStartInfo
{
FileName = powershellPath,
Arguments = $"-NoProfile -ExecutionPolicy Bypass -File \"{_options.BackendScriptPath}\"",
WorkingDirectory = _options.WorkingDirectory,
RedirectStandardOutput = true,
RedirectStandardError = true,
UseShellExecute = false,
CreateNoWindow = true
};
_backendProcess = new Process { StartInfo = startInfo };
if (!_backendProcess.Start())
{
throw new InvalidOperationException("Failed to start backend process.");
}
LogStdOut($"Backend process started with PID {_backendProcess.Id}.");
_logger.LogInformation("Backend process started with PID {Pid}.", _backendProcess.Id);
var stdoutPump = PumpStreamAsync(_backendProcess.StandardOutput, LogStdOut, stoppingToken);
var stderrPump = PumpStreamAsync(_backendProcess.StandardError, LogStdErr, stoppingToken);
try
{
await _backendProcess.WaitForExitAsync(stoppingToken);
var exitCode = _backendProcess.ExitCode;
LogStdErr($"Backend process exited unexpectedly with code {exitCode}.");
_logger.LogError("Backend process exited unexpectedly with code {ExitCode}.", exitCode);
Environment.ExitCode = exitCode == 0 ? 1 : exitCode;
throw new InvalidOperationException(
$"Backend process ended unexpectedly. Service host exit code: {Environment.ExitCode}.");
}
catch (OperationCanceledException)
{
LogStdOut("Service stop requested.");
}
finally
{
await Task.WhenAll(stdoutPump, stderrPump);
}
}
public override async Task StopAsync(CancellationToken cancellationToken)
{
if (_backendProcess is { HasExited: false })
{
try
{
LogStdOut("Stopping backend process.");
_backendProcess.Kill(entireProcessTree: true);
}
catch (Exception ex)
{
LogStdErr($"Failed to stop backend process cleanly: {ex.Message}");
_logger.LogError(ex, "Failed to stop backend process cleanly.");
}
}
await base.StopAsync(cancellationToken);
}
private async Task PumpStreamAsync(
StreamReader reader,
Action<string> sink,
CancellationToken stoppingToken)
{
while (!stoppingToken.IsCancellationRequested)
{
var line = await reader.ReadLineAsync();
if (line is null)
{
break;
}
sink(line);
}
}
private void LogStdOut(string message)
{
WriteLog(_stdoutLogPath, message);
}
private void LogStdErr(string message)
{
WriteLog(_stderrLogPath, message);
}
private void WriteLog(string path, string message)
{
var stamp = DateTimeOffset.Now.ToString("yyyy-MM-dd HH:mm:ss");
var line = $"[{stamp}] {message}{Environment.NewLine}";
lock (_logLock)
{
File.AppendAllText(path, line);
}
}
}

[CmdletBinding()]
param(
[ValidateSet("start", "stop", "restart")]
[string]$Action,
[string]$ServiceName = "ScreenJobBackend"
)
Set-StrictMode -Version Latest
$ErrorActionPreference = "Stop"
function Wait-ForStatus {
param(
[Parameter(Mandatory = $true)]$Service,
[Parameter(Mandatory = $true)][System.ServiceProcess.ServiceControllerStatus]$TargetStatus,
[int]$TimeoutSeconds = 20
)
$deadline = (Get-Date).AddSeconds($TimeoutSeconds)
while ((Get-Date) -lt $deadline) {
$Service.Refresh()
if ($Service.Status -eq $TargetStatus) {
return
}
Start-Sleep -Milliseconds 350
}
throw "Timed out waiting for service '$($Service.ServiceName)' to reach status '$TargetStatus'."
}
$service = Get-Service -Name $ServiceName -ErrorAction Stop
switch ($Action) {
"start" {
if ($service.Status -ne [System.ServiceProcess.ServiceControllerStatus]::Running) {
Start-Service -Name $ServiceName -ErrorAction Stop
Wait-ForStatus -Service $service -TargetStatus ([System.ServiceProcess.ServiceControllerStatus]::Running)
}
}
"stop" {
if ($service.Status -ne [System.ServiceProcess.ServiceControllerStatus]::Stopped) {
Stop-Service -Name $ServiceName -Force -ErrorAction Stop
Wait-ForStatus -Service $service -TargetStatus ([System.ServiceProcess.ServiceControllerStatus]::Stopped)
}
}
"restart" {
if ($service.Status -eq [System.ServiceProcess.ServiceControllerStatus]::Running) {
Restart-Service -Name $ServiceName -Force -ErrorAction Stop
} else {
Start-Service -Name $ServiceName -ErrorAction Stop
}
Wait-ForStatus -Service $service -TargetStatus ([System.ServiceProcess.ServiceControllerStatus]::Running)
}
}
